Why Most First‑Try Sculptures Fail

Your first attempts probably look great on paper but collapse under their own weight. The root cause isn’t a lack of talent; it’s missing design welded steel sculpture fundamentals: load paths, proper steel gauge, and a solid weld plan. Ignoring these basics leads to wobbly joints, cracked welds, and endless frustration.

Common Design Mistakes

  1. Relying only on the sketch – A line drawing shows shape, not structure.
  2. Choosing the wrong steel thickness – Thin ¼‑inch tube bends under modest loads.
  3. Overlooking the load path – Without a clear path for weight transfer, joints bear unnecessary stress.
  4. Skipping a test fit – Welding blind often reveals misalignments after the fact.

Addressing each of these points turns a shaky prototype into a reliable artwork.

Proven Workflow for a Stable Welded Steel Sculpture

Step Action Why It Matters
1. Sketch the silhouette Capture only the overall shape. Gives you a visual target without getting lost in details.
2. Add structural boxes Overlay rectangles where the biggest loads occur. Creates a load path that guides weld placement.
**3. Select proper steel thickness Use ½‑inch plate for primary supports; thinner sections are fine for decorative arms. Guarantees the sculpture can bear its own weight.
4. Draft a rough welding plan Order the welds from strongest (usually the base) upward. Prevents premature distortion and concentrates heat where it’s needed.
5. Test‑fit on the floor Bolt pieces together temporarily and verify alignment. Catches errors before the torch fires.
6. Execute the final weld Follow the plan, keep the torch moving, and maintain consistent penetration. Produces strong, crack‑free joints.
7. Prepare the surface Grind sharp edges, then sandblast or wire‑brush the whole piece. Improves finish adhesion and safety.
8. Install with confidence Use a level, sturdy brackets, and anchor points identified in your how to plan a welded steel sculpture for installation checklist. Ensures the sculpture stays upright in its final setting.

Following this step‑by‑step welded steel sculpture design process typically takes a weekend when you stay organized, and it eliminates the dreaded “first‑time weld crack” scenario.
